How it fits together
One path, from the machine to the referrer.
Unomed sits between your image sources and everyone who needs the images afterwards. What happens in between, you set up once.
-
Messenger it
Your own modalities connect through the cloud connector, an existing PACS or RIS through the Radiology Bridge. Whoever made them, with no CD and without changing the systems you run.
-
Store it
Studies from inside and outside sit together in certified Swiss data centres. Storage grows with you, roles and permissions apply per person, and you can pull your archive back out as DICOM at any time.
-
View it and pass it on
The viewer runs in the browser with nothing installed. Images appear in the patient record instead of a second program, and sharing happens by link and case chat instead of by CD.

Common questions about Unomed Cloud PACS
Why is Unomed's PACS cheaper than other solutions?
Because it is cloud software that grows with the practice, rather than a server you have to house and look after. The data sits encrypted in certified Swiss data centres, which takes most of the maintenance cost and IT work out of the picture.
How do I share DICOM studies with someone else?
You share them in the Unomed messenger, encrypted and without a second tool. Recipients do not need an account: anyone who is not registered gets a time-limited guest link by email, and anyone who is sees the study in the messenger.
How does patient matching work?
If the DICOM order started from the patient record, there is nothing to match, the assignment is already settled. In every other case Unomed suggests the patient it belongs to, even where the name is spelled differently or the record exists twice. Confirming it is your call.
Which devices can I connect to the PACS?
Any DICOM-capable modality, so ultrasound, X-ray or MRI. The Unomed cloud connector that comes with it handles the connection.
Can I bring my existing PACS data across?
Yes. Existing DICOM data or whole archives can be migrated. Our team helps with the connection.
Which DICOM viewers can I use?
The OHIF viewer from the Open Health Imaging Foundation as standard. We connect others when a customer asks for them.
Can I open images from my practice software?
Yes. Unomed opens the study in the built-in DICOM viewer, with no plugin and no separate program. It hooks in through a link or a button in your primary software.
Do I need extra hardware or plugins?
No. Using it takes neither special hardware nor plugins. To connect your equipment, our cloud connector is installed once in the practice network.
How secure is the PACS?
All data is transmitted encrypted and stored in certified Swiss data centres under the Swiss Data Protection Act. The built-in DICOM viewer is zero footprint: it runs in the browser and leaves nothing behind.
Is artificial intelligence used in the PACS?
Yes, when studies from outside are assigned. The AI suggests which study belongs to which patient; you confirm it. That saves time and cuts down on studies filed under the wrong name.
